His failure does not lie in his films but in his produced films. In 1999, with Juhi Chawla and director Aziz Mirza, Shahrukh Khan set up his production company, Dreamz Unlimited up. The very first two films from his production house, Phir Bhi Dil Hai Hindustani and ‘Asoka’ were beaten at the box office. Even his production house Red Chillies Entertainment’s IPL team Kolkata Knight Riders proved to be a bit of a failure though it did help his public image till some extent.
Shahrukh’s television stint was also not very sounding. Shah Rukh hosted Kya Aap Paanchvi Pass Se Tez Hain? And earlier Kaun Banega Crorepati 3 failed to make a good television prospect.
